About

Ray L. Wong is an employment and labor attorney with 13 years of legal experience, practicing at Duane Morris LLP in San Francisco, CA. He earned a B.A. from University of Utah in 1975 and a J.D. from Harvard University Law School in 1978. He is admitted to practice in Washington (since 2012), Idaho (since 1993), and California (since 1978). His practice encompasses employment and labor, business, and litigation, allowing him to serve clients across a range of legal needs. He ma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
